Parking Tips

Guidelines for stress-free parking

Carr Mill is a vibrant hub for shopping, dining, and business in Carrboro, NC. Parking is for active patrons, shoppers, and diners only. Thank you for parking responsibly.

 

We enforce a strict parking policy. If you park here and leave the property, your vehicle will be towed.

 

We use a camera system to monitor the parking lot to ensure safety and prevent unauthorized parking. This is a standard practice in many shopping centers.

OUR HISTORY

Historical building in Carrboro, NC.

In 1898 Tom Lloyd built Alberta, the cotton mill that was his pride and joy, in a small town originally known as West End, as in west end of Chapel Hill. Alberta nudged forward a period of growth for Venable, the community’s second name, in honor of the UNC President, turning it into a real town.
